Page Background Layer - XX5 Bug?
1) Drag a colour to the page background - the Page Background layer appears in the Object gallery.
2) Ensure that Page Background is the currently selected layer.
3) Draw a Quickshape (you will have to click OK in the dialog box)...
4) ...and now try to delete it!
You can't since the Page Background layer is unselectable.
Nor can you drag it to another layer in the Object Gallery.
The only ways to get shot of it are to delete the entrie Page Background layer, or Undo to a point before the shape's creation.
Small bug, but annoying none the less!

I may be missing something here (wouldn't be the first time!) but it seems like the problem (such as it is) is that the page background layer is locked by default when it's created. If you unlock the layer you can select/edit/delete the object normally.
This seems somewhat like a feature since you probably don't want to accidentally mess up your background while editing.

Not really a bug.
Been this way since versions 1.
As Odat say's, unlock the layer and proceed as normal, though note that *objects* on the background layer don't show in a web preview.

As mentioned the background layer is locked and can only be unlocked by selecting 'Properties' in the object docker (after being on the Background layer) then you make it editable.
